Understanding Odd Prediction Tools
Odd prediction tools are designed to provide insights into future events based on unusual patterns or anomalies in data. Unlike traditional prediction models that rely heavily on historical data and statistical analysis, odd prediction tools often leverage unconventional data sources and methodologies. This can include social media sentiment analysis, environmental changes, and even astrological data.
At their core, odd prediction tools seek to identify outliers or unexpected variables that may influence future outcomes. For instance, an odd prediction tool might analyze social media chatter around a new product launch, considering not just sales data but also public sentiment, influencer endorsements, and even memes circulating online. By integrating these diverse data points, the tool can generate a prediction that reflects the complex realities of consumer behavior.
The Mechanics of Odd Prediction Tools
So how do these tools actually work? The mechanics behind odd prediction tools can vary significantly, but they typically involve several key components:
- Data Collection: This is the foundation of any prediction tool. Odd prediction tools gather data from various sources, including social media platforms, news articles, market trends, and even user-generated content.
- Data Analysis: Once collected, the data undergoes rigorous analysis. Using machine learning algorithms and natural language processing, these tools sift through vast amounts of information to identify patterns and anomalies.
- Modeling Predictions: After analyzing the data, the tool employs predictive modeling techniques to generate forecasts. These models can range from simple linear regression to complex neural networks.
- Feedback Loops: Many odd prediction tools incorporate feedback mechanisms that allow them to learn from past predictions. This iterative process helps refine the accuracy of future forecasts.

Challenges and Limitations of Odd Prediction Tools
While odd prediction tools offer innovative insights, they are not without challenges. Here are a few limitations that users should be aware of:
- Data Quality: The accuracy of predictions is heavily dependent on the quality of data. Inaccurate or biased data can lead to misleading forecasts.
- Complexity of Models: The algorithms used in odd prediction tools can be quite complex, making them difficult for non-experts to interpret.
- Ethical Concerns: The use of personal data, particularly from social media, raises ethical considerations regarding privacy and consent.
